The cigar industry was put under attack in 2014 by the FDA and we have seen a consolidation in the industry as a result of it. It is expected that by April of 2015 we should know where the chips fall on this all important regulation. We will have continued coverage on this throughout the year.

One of the big 2014 announcements was the surprise opening of relations with the nation of Cuba. This has and will be controversial as it moves forward. There is much to work out and it is sure to be dotting the headlines throughout 2015.
